For the months leading up to February, supposed leaks and speculation were in abundance surrounding rumors of potentialPokemon DiamondandPearlremakes for the Nintendo Switch. While fans were excited to finally learn thatPokemon Brilliant DiamondandShining Pearlwould release sometime later this year, it has largely been radio-silence from The Pokemon Company on both the Gen 4 remakes and thesurprise-reveal ofPokemon Legends: Arceus.

Unlike other remakes in thePokemonseries,Brilliant DiamondandShining Pearltake a noticeably more faithful approach in remaking the 2006 Nintendo DS games. While the more faithfully-adapted chibi artstyle received mixed reactions among fans, many are simply eager to learn more about the remakes, and although The Pokemon Company has been silent, an insider has revealed some new info onBrilliant DiamondandShining Pearl.

The news comes by way of credible Nintendo insider KeliosFR, whose tweets were translated by popularPokemonleak Twitter account Centro Pokemon LEAKS. Kelios released several quick, but telling pieces of info onBrilliant DiamondandShining Pearl. Among other tidbits, Kelios revealed that news on the games won’t come before June,the reveal trailer for the remakesfeatured a build from January, though the games are mostly just being polished now, and that the games' release date is set.

It’s worth noting that Kelios' mention of June may be a more telling month than it appears at a glance, asNintendo was confirmed to appear at E3this year, so it is likely that fans will learn more information onBrilliant DiamondandShining Pearlcome E3 this summer. Graphic polishing is something that some fans may be happy to hear, as upon the games' reveal, many voiced that they thought adding a thick, black outline to the character models in the overworld could make them stand out more and fit the chibi artstyle a bit better. Finally, it’s reassuring to know that a release date is set in stone now, as it will likely also be revealed if new info comes at E3. Many fans expect the games to release in November, as other recentPokemongames have.

Other tidbits Kelios had to reveal included that the footage from thePokemon Legends: Arceusreveal trailer in February was from a December 2020 build, so the game may have been further along in development than when fans first saw it. Additionally, Kelios mentions that the exact “early 2022"release date forPokemon Legendsisn’t set just yet, but will be defined later in the year.

Finally, Kelios threw in a quick tease by mentioning that Nintendo has another big game planned for release in 2022. This could be any number of things as far as fans are concerned,fromMetroid Prime 4to the sequel toThe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ild. For the meantime, fans may be able to rest assured knowing that progress on the upcomingPokemongames is going smoothly.

Pokemon Brilliant DiamondandShining Pearlwill release in late 2021 on the Switch.
